Rancher无法添加主机问题的解决方法

Rancher是一款优秀的容器管理平台,它可以帮助我们方便地管理Docker容器。在使用Rancher时,有时会遇到无法添加主机的问题。本文将详细讲解Rancher无法添加主机问题的解决方法,并提供两个示例说明。

1. 检查主机连接

在Rancher中,我们需要确保主机能够连接到Rancher服务器。如果主机无法连接到Rancher服务器,则无法添加主机。我们可以使用ping命令或telnet命令来测试主机是否能够连接到Rancher服务器。例如:

ping rancher-server-ip
telnet rancher-server-ip 8080

在上面的示例中,我们使用ping命令和telnet命令来测试主机是否能够连接到Rancher服务器。如果连接成功,则说明主机可以连接到Rancher服务器。

2. 检查主机证书

在Rancher中,我们需要确保主机证书正确。如果主机证书不正确,则无法添加主机。我们可以使用openssl命令来测试主机证书是否正确。例如:

openssl s_client -connect rancher-server-ip:443

在上面的示例中,我们使用openssl命令来测试主机证书是否正确。如果证书正确,则会输出证书信息。

示例一

以下是一个使用Rancher添加主机的示例:

  1. 在Rancher中,选择“Infrastructure” -> “Hosts” -> “Add Host”。
  2. 在“Add Host”页面中,输入主机的IP地址和SSH凭据,并选择要添加主机的环境。
  3. 点击“Create”按钮,等待主机添加完成。

在上面的示例中,我们使用Rancher添加主机。首先,我们选择“Infrastructure” -> “Hosts” -> “Add Host”来打开“Add Host”页面。然后,我们输入主机的IP地址和SSH凭据,并选择要添加主机的环境。最后,我们点击“Create”按钮,等待主机添加完成。

示例二

以下是另一个使用Rancher添加主机的示例:

  1. 在Rancher中,选择“Infrastructure” -> “Hosts” -> “Custom”。
  2. 在“Custom”页面中,输入主机的IP地址和SSH凭据,并选择要添加主机的环境。
  3. 点击“Save”按钮,等待主机添加完成。

在上面的示例中,我们使用Rancher添加主机。首先,我们选择“Infrastructure” -> “Hosts” -> “Custom”来打开“Custom”页面。然后,我们输入主机的IP地址和SSH凭据,并选择要添加主机的环境。最后,我们点击“Save”按钮,等待主机添加完成。

总结

通过以上步骤,我们可以解决Rancher无法添加主机的问题。首先,我们需要确保主机能够连接到Rancher服务器,并检查主机证书是否正确。然后,我们可以使用Rancher的“Add Host”或“Custom”页面来添加主机。最后,我们等待主机添加完成即可。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Rancher无法添加主机问题的解决方法 - Python技术站

(0)
上一篇 2023年5月16日
下一篇 2023年5月16日

相关文章

  • springcloud微服务之Eureka配置详解

    Spring Cloud微服务之Eureka配置详解 本攻略将详细讲解如何在Spring Cloud微服务架构中配置Eureka,并提供两个示例说明。 准备工作 在开始之前,需要准备以下工具和环境: JDK。可以从官网下载并安装JDK。 Maven。可以从官网下载并安装Maven。 Spring Boot。可以从官网下载并安装Spring Boot。 Eur…

    微服务 2023年5月16日
    00
  • Spring Cloud微服务架构Sentinel数据双向同步

    Spring Cloud微服务架构Sentinel数据双向同步攻略 本攻略将详细讲解Spring Cloud微服务架构Sentinel数据双向同步的完整过程,包括Sentinel的配置、数据同步的实现、使用方法和示例说明。 Sentinel的配置 在pom.xml中添加以下依赖: <dependency> <groupId>com.a…

    微服务 2023年5月16日
    00
  • 从0到1搭建后端架构的演进(MVC,服务拆分,微服务,领域驱动)

    从0到1搭建后端架构的演进(MVC,服务拆分,微服务,领域驱动) 在软件开发中,后端架构的演进是一个不断迭代的过程。从最初的MVC架构到服务拆分、微服务和领域驱动设计,每一次演进都是为了更好地满足业务需求和技术发展。本攻略将详细讲解从0到1搭建后端架构的演进,包括MVC架构、服务拆分、微服务和领域驱动设计,并提供两个示例说明。 MVC架构 MVC架构是一种常…

    微服务 2023年5月16日
    00
  • SpringCloud Ribbon与OpenFeign详解如何实现服务调用

    SpringCloud Ribbon与OpenFeign详解如何实现服务调用 在微服务架构中,服务之间的调用是非常常见的。SpringCloud提供了Ribbon和OpenFeign等组件,可以实现服务之间的调用。本攻略将详细讲解SpringCloud Ribbon与OpenFeign如何实现服务调用,包括服务注册与发现、负载均衡、服务调用等内容。 服务注册…

    微服务 2023年5月16日
    00
  • golang中使用proto3协议导致的空值字段不显示的问题处理方案

    golang中使用proto3协议导致的空值字段不显示的问题处理方案 在golang中使用proto3协议时,可能会遇到空值字段不显示的问题。这个问题通常是由于proto3协议的默认值机制引起的。本文将详细讲解如何解决这个问题,并提供两个示例说明。 问题描述 在golang中使用proto3协议时,如果一个字段的值为空,则该字段将不会显示在输出中。这个问题通…

    微服务 2023年5月16日
    00
  • 使用FeignClient进行微服务交互方式(微服务接口互相调用)

    使用FeignClient进行微服务交互方式(微服务接口互相调用) 本攻略将详细讲解如何使用FeignClient进行微服务交互,以实现微服务接口互相调用,并提供两个示例。 准备工作 在开始之前,需要准备以下工具和环境: JDK。可以从官网下载并安装JDK。 Spring Boot。可以从官网下载并安装Spring Boot。 Maven。可以从官网下载并安…

    微服务 2023年5月16日
    00
  • 微服务和分布式的区别详解

    微服务和分布式的区别详解 微服务和分布式是两个常见的概念,它们在软件架构中都扮演着重要的角色。虽然它们有一些相似之处,但它们之间也存在一些区别。在本攻略中,我们将详细讲解微服务和分布式的区别,并提供两个示例说明。 微服务和分布式的区别 以下是微服务和分布式的区别: 定义 微服务是一种架构风格,它将一个大型的单体应用拆分成多个小型的服务,每个服务都可以独立部署…

    微服务 2023年5月16日
    00
  • Docker中部署Redis集群与部署微服务项目的详细过程

    Docker中部署Redis集群与部署微服务项目的详细过程 Docker是一种流行的容器化技术,可以帮助我们快速、方便地部署和管理应用程序。在本攻略中,我们将介绍如何使用Docker来部署Redis集群和微服务项目,并提供两个示例说明。 部署Redis集群 Redis是一种流行的内存数据库,可以用于缓存、消息队列等应用场景。在本攻略中,我们将介绍如何使用Do…

    微服务 2023年5月16日
    00
合作推广
合作推广
分享本页
返回顶部